class TreeWidget(QtGui.QTreeWidget):
    def __init__(self, main):
        super(TreeWidget, self).__init__(main)
        self.header().setHidden(True)
        self.setWindowTitle('Resources')
        self.setDragDropMode(QtGui.QAbstractItemView.InternalMove)
        self.main = main
        self.connect(self, QtCore.SIGNAL("itemDoubleClicked(QTreeWidgetItem*, int)"),self.DoEvent)
        self.connect(self, QtCore.SIGNAL("itemCollapsed(QTreeWidgetItem *)"), self.itemCollapsed)
        self.connect(self, QtCore.SIGNAL("itemExpanded(QTreeWidgetItem *)"), self.itemExpanded)
        self.Path = {}

        lastposition= QtCore.QPoint(-32,-32)
        self.nwindows = 0
        
        
        self.Names = self.main.Names
        self.ImageNames = (None, 'sound.png', 'backgrounds.png', 'font.png', 'script.png', 'object.png', 'game.png')
        self.Parent = {}
        self.ImageName = {}
        j=0
        for i in self.Names:
            self.ImageName[i] = self.ImageNames[j]
            j+=1
        
    def itemCollapsed(self, obj):
        self.main.expanded[str(obj.text(0))] = False

    def itemExpanded(self, obj):
        self.main.expanded[str(obj.text(0))] = True

    def contextMenuEvent(self, event):
        menu = QtGui.QMenu(self)
        insertAction = menu.addAction("Insert")
        insertAction.triggered.connect(self.InsertItem)
        duplicateAction = menu.addAction("Duplicate")
        duplicateAction.setShortcut('Alt+Ins')
        duplicateAction.setDisabled (True)
        menu.addSeparator()
        insertgroupAction = menu.addAction("Insert Group")
        insertgroupAction.setShortcut('Shift+Ins')
        insertgroupAction.setDisabled (True)
        menu.addSeparator()
        deleteAction = menu.addAction("Delete")
        deleteAction.setShortcut('Shift+Del')
        deleteAction.triggered.connect(self.DeleteEvent)
        deleteAction.setDisabled (False)
        menu.addSeparator()
        renameAction = menu.addAction("Rename")
        renameAction.setShortcut('F2')
        renameAction.setDisabled (True)
        menu.addSeparator()
        propertiesAction = menu.addAction("Properties...")
        propertiesAction.setShortcut('Alt+Enter')
        propertiesAction.triggered.connect(self.DoEvent)
        action = menu.exec_(self.mapToGlobal(event.pos()))
        
    def DeleteEvent(self):
        def openWindow(directory):
            if item.parent().text(0) == directory:
                itemtext = str(item.text(0))

                if directory == "Sprites":
                    print ("TODO")
                elif directory == "Backgrounds":
                    reply = QtGui.QMessageBox.question(self, "Confirm", 'You are about to delete "'+itemtext+'". This will be permanent. Continue?', QtGui.QMessageBox.Yes, QtGui.QMessageBox.No)
                    if reply == QtGui.QMessageBox.Yes:
                        os.remove(os.path.join(self.main.dirname, directory, itemtext+".png"))
                elif directory == "Sounds":
                    print ("TODO")
                elif directory == "Fonts":
                    print ("TODO")
                elif directory == "Scripts":
                    reply = QtGui.QMessageBox.question(self, "Confirm", 'You are about to delete "'+itemtext+'". This will be permanent. Continue?', QtGui.QMessageBox.Yes, QtGui.QMessageBox.No)
                    if reply == QtGui.QMessageBox.Yes:
                        os.remove(os.path.join(self.main.dirname, directory, itemtext+".py"))
                elif directory == "Objects":
                    reply = QtGui.QMessageBox.question(self, "Confirm", 'You are about to delete "'+itemtext+'". This will be permanent. Continue?', QtGui.QMessageBox.Yes, QtGui.QMessageBox.No)
                    if reply == QtGui.QMessageBox.Yes:
                        os.remove(os.path.join(self.main.dirname, directory, itemtext+".ini"))
                elif directory == "Rooms":
                    reply = QtGui.QMessageBox.question(self, "Confirm", 'You are about to delete "'+itemtext+'". This will be permanent. Continue?', QtGui.QMessageBox.Yes, QtGui.QMessageBox.No)
                    if reply == QtGui.QMessageBox.Yes:
                        os.remove(os.path.join(self.main.dirname, directory, itemtext+".py"))

                if directory[-1:] == "s":
                    directory = directory[:-1]

                self.main.updatetree()

            def GameSettings():
                print ("hola")
        
        item = self.currentItem()
        if not item.parent() == None:
            for name in self.Names:
                openWindow(name)
                
    def DoEvent(self, itemtext=False):
        def openWindow(directory, itemtext=None):
            if itemtext == None:
                itemtext = str(item.text(0))
                if item.parent().text(0) != directory:
                    return

            try:
                lastposition = self.main.qmdiarea.activeSubWindow().pos()
            except:
                lastposition = QtCore.QPoint(-25,-25)

            if directory == "Sprites":
                self.window = SpriteGUI(self.main, itemtext, self.main.dirname, self)
            elif directory == "Backgrounds":
                self.window = BackgroundGUI(self.main, itemtext, self.main.dirname, self)
            elif directory == "Sounds":
                self.window = SoundGUI(self.main, itemtext, self.main.dirname, self)
            elif directory == "Fonts":
                self.window = FontGUI(self.main, itemtext, self.main.dirname, self)
            elif directory == "Scripts":
                self.window = ScriptGUI(self.main, itemtext, self.main.dirname, self)
            elif directory == "Objects":
                self.window = ObjectGUI(self.main, itemtext, self.main.dirname, self)
            elif directory == "Rooms":
                self.window = RoomGUI(self.main, itemtext, self.main.dirname, self)

            #Check for existing window to focus on, if not create one
            windowTitle = directory[:-1] + " properties: " + itemtext
            
            windowList = self.main.qmdiarea.subWindowList()
            
            existingWindowFound = False
            
            #TODO: loops through windows checking for matching title, 
            #gotta be a better way to find existing window
            for existingWindow in windowList: 
                if (existingWindow.windowTitle() == windowTitle):
                    self.window = existingWindow
                    self.main.qmdiarea.setActiveSubWindow(self.window)
                    existingWindowFound = True
                    break
            
            #create a new window, if one doesn't exist
            if not existingWindowFound:
                self.window.setWindowTitle( windowTitle )
                self.main.qmdiarea.addSubWindow(self.window)
                self.nwindows += 1 #creating a new window, increment window count
            
            #new or old, make the window visible
            self.window.setVisible(True)
            
            #if window is new, set icon/geometry
            if not existingWindowFound:
                if directory == "Sprites":
                    self.main.qmdiarea.activeSubWindow().setWindowIcon(QtGui.QIcon(os.path.join('Data', 'sprite.png')))
                elif directory == "Sounds":
                    self.main.qmdiarea.activeSubWindow().setWindowIcon(QtGui.QIcon(os.path.join('Data', 'sound.png')))
                elif directory == "Scripts":
                    self.main.qmdiarea.activeSubWindow().setWindowIcon(QtGui.QIcon(os.path.join('Data', 'script.png')))
                elif directory == "Rooms":
                    self.main.qmdiarea.activeSubWindow().setWindowIcon(QtGui.QIcon(os.path.join('Data', 'room.png')))
                elif directory == "Objects":
                    self.main.qmdiarea.activeSubWindow().setWindowIcon(QtGui.QIcon(os.path.join('Data', self.ImageName[directory[:-1] + 's'])))
                    self.main.qmdiarea.activeSubWindow().setGeometry(0, 0, 520, 380)
                else:
                    self.main.qmdiarea.activeSubWindow().setWindowIcon(QtGui.QIcon(os.path.join('Data', self.ImageName[directory[:-1] + 's'])))

            #move window to proper location on screen
            if self.nwindows == 1: #first window
                self.main.qmdiarea.activeSubWindow().move(0,0) #show in top left corner
            elif (not existingWindowFound): #new window, but not first window
                self.main.qmdiarea.activeSubWindow().move(lastposition+QtCore.QPoint(25,25))
            else: #old window
                pass #keep in last known position 
                
            def GameSettings():
                print ("hola")

        

        if "QtGui" in str(itemtext):
            item = self.currentItem()
            if not item.parent() == None:
                for name in self.Names:
                    openWindow(name)
                        
        else:
            openWindow('Sprites', itemtext)

                    

    def InsertItem(self):
        item = self.currentItem()    
        itemtext = str(item.text(0))
        if itemtext == "Sprites":
            self.main.addSprite()
        elif itemtext == "Sounds":
            self.main.addSound()
        elif itemtext == "Backgrounds":
            self.main.addBackground()
        elif itemtext == "Fonts":
            self.main.addFont()
        elif itemtext == "Scripts":
            self.main.addScript()
        elif itemtext == "Objects":
            self.main.addObject()
        elif itemtext == "Rooms":
            self.main.addRoom()
        
    def InitParent(self):
        
        for name in self.Names:
            icon = QtGui.QIcon()
            icon.addPixmap(QtGui.QPixmap(os.path.join("Data", "folder.png")), QtGui.QIcon.Normal, QtGui.QIcon.Off)
            self.Parent[name] = QtGui.QTreeWidgetItem(self, StringList([name]))
            self.Parent[name].setIcon(0,icon)
            
        iconpref = QtGui.QIcon()
        iconpref.addPixmap(QtGui.QPixmap(os.path.join("Data", "treepreferences.png")), QtGui.QIcon.Normal, QtGui.QIcon.Off)
        self.ggs = QtGui.QTreeWidgetItem(self, StringList(["Global Game Settings"]))
        self.ggs.setIcon(0,iconpref)
        
    def InitChild(self, fillarrays=False):
        dirname = self.main.dirname
        self.InitParsers()
        
        for name in self.Names:
            self.Path[name] = os.path.join(dirname, name)
            
            if name == "Fonts":
                for section in self.fnt_parser.sections():
                    icon = QtGui.QIcon()
                    icon.addPixmap(QtGui.QPixmap(os.path.join("Data", self.ImageName[name])), QtGui.QIcon.Normal, QtGui.QIcon.Off)               
                    QtGui.QTreeWidgetItem(self.Parent[name], StringList(section)).setIcon(0,icon)
            else:
                for ChildSource in sorted(os.listdir(self.Path[name])):
                    ChildSource = str(ChildSource)
                    icon = QtGui.QIcon()
                    if name == "Sprites" or name == "Backgrounds":
                        icon.addPixmap(QtGui.QPixmap(os.path.join(self.Path[name], ChildSource)), QtGui.QIcon.Normal, QtGui.QIcon.Off)
                    elif name =="Objects":
                        self.config = configparser.ConfigParser()
                        self.config.read(os.path.join(self.Path[name], ChildSource))
                        currentsprite = self.config.get('data', 'sprite', 0)
                        currentsprite = str(currentsprite)+".png"
                        icon.addPixmap(QtGui.QPixmap(os.path.join(self.Path["Sprites"], currentsprite)), QtGui.QIcon.Normal, QtGui.QIcon.Off)
                    else:
                        icon.addPixmap(QtGui.QPixmap(os.path.join("Data", self.ImageName[name])), QtGui.QIcon.Normal, QtGui.QIcon.Off)               

                    if name == "Sprites" or name == "Sounds" or name == "Backgrounds":
                        if ChildSource.endswith(".ini"):#skips the .ini of sprite information
                            continue

                        
                        if "-0" in ChildSource[:-4]: #now checking if it's an animated sprite
                            QtGui.QTreeWidgetItem(self.Parent[name], StringList([ChildSource[:-6]])).setIcon(0,icon)
                        elif "-" in ChildSource[:-4]:
                            continue
                        else:
                            QtGui.QTreeWidgetItem(self.Parent[name], StringList([ChildSource[:-4]])).setIcon(0,icon)
                        
                    elif name == "Scripts" or name == "Rooms":
                        QtGui.QTreeWidgetItem(self.Parent[name], StringList([ChildSource[:-3]])).setIcon(0,icon)
                    elif name == "Objects":
                        if ChildSource.endswith(".ini"):
                            QtGui.QTreeWidgetItem(self.Parent[name], StringList([ChildSource[:-4]])).setIcon(0,icon)
                        else:
                            continue                    
                    
                    if fillarrays:
                        self.main.Sources[name].append(ChildSource)

    def InitParsers(self):
        self.spr_parser = configparser.RawConfigParser()
        self.spr_parser.read(os.path.join(self.main.dirname, 'Sprites', 'spriteconfig.ini'))

        self.snd_parser = configparser.RawConfigParser()
        self.snd_parser.read(os.path.join(self.main.dirname, 'Sounds', 'soundconfig.ini'))

        self.fnt_parser = configparser.RawConfigParser()
        self.fnt_parser.read(os.path.join(self.main.dirname, 'Fonts', 'fontconfig.ini'))

        #TODO: soundparser...etc

    def write_sprites(self):
        with open(os.path.join(self.main.dirname, 'Sprites', 'spriteconfig.ini'), 'w') as configfile:
            self.spr_parser.write(configfile)

    def write_sound(self):
        with open(os.path.join(self.main.dirname, 'Sounds', 'soundconfig.ini'), 'w') as configfile:
            self.snd_parser.write(configfile)

    def write_fonts(self):
        with open(os.path.join(self.main.dirname, 'Fonts', 'fontconfig.ini'), 'w') as configfile:
            self.fnt_parser.write(configfile)

    def add_sprite_section(self, name):
        self.spr_parser.add_section(name[:-4])
        if name[-3:]=="gif":
            self.spr_parser.set(name[:-4], 'extension', 'png')
        else:
            self.spr_parser.set(name[:-4], 'extension', name[-3:])
        self.spr_parser.set(name[:-4], 'xorig', 0)
        self.spr_parser.set(name[:-4], 'yorig', 0)

        self.write_sprites()

    def add_sound_section(self, name):
        self.snd_parser.add_section(name[:-4])
        self.snd_parser.set(name[:-4], 'extension', name[-3:])
        self.snd_parser.set(name[:-4], 'volume', '0')
        self.snd_parser.set(name[:-4], 'pan', '0')

        self.write_sound()

    def add_font_section(self, name):
        self.fnt_parser.add_section(name)
        self.fnt_parser.set(name, 'font', '')
        self.fnt_parser.set(name, 'fontindex', '')
        self.fnt_parser.set(name, 'size', '')
        self.fnt_parser.set(name, 'bold', 'False')
        self.fnt_parser.set(name, 'italic', 'False')
        self.fnt_parser.set(name, 'antialiasing', 'False')

        self.write_fonts()
        
    def addChild(self, directory, name):
        icon = QtGui.QIcon()
        
        if directory == 'Sprites':
            if "gif" in name:
                icon.addPixmap(QtGui.QPixmap(os.path.join(self.Path[directory], name[:-4]+"-0.png")), QtGui.QIcon.Normal, QtGui.QIcon.Off)
            else:
                icon.addPixmap(QtGui.QPixmap(os.path.join(self.Path[directory], name)), QtGui.QIcon.Normal, QtGui.QIcon.Off)
            self.add_sprite_section(name)
        else:
            icon.addPixmap(QtGui.QPixmap(os.path.join("Data", self.ImageName[directory])), QtGui.QIcon.Normal, QtGui.QIcon.Off)
            if directory == 'Sounds':
                self.add_sound_section(name)
            elif directory == 'Fonts':
                self.add_font_section(name)
                
               
        if directory == 'Scripts' or directory =='Rooms' or directory =='Objects' or directory == 'Fonts':
            QtGui.QTreeWidgetItem(self.Parent[directory], StringList([name])).setIcon(0,icon)
        else:
            QtGui.QTreeWidgetItem(self.Parent[directory], StringList([name[:-4]])).setIcon(0,icon)
